Back to Roofing
Roofing · Workflow

Customer communication and project updates

Automates customer communications throughout roofing projects by sending targeted updates based on project milestones and capturing visual progress documentation. Improves customer satisfaction and reduces manual communication overhead.

Workflow Trigger

Project status changes in JobNimbus (scheduled, in progress, materials delivered, completion)

Visual Flow

Each node represents an automated step. Connections show how data and decisions move through the workflow.

Step-by-Step Breakdown

Detailed explanation of each automated stage in the workflow.

  1. 1
    Trigger

    Project Status Update Detected

    JobNimbus triggers workflow when project milestone is reached or status changes. System captures current project phase and customer contact information.

  2. 2
    Action

    Retrieve Project Details

    Pulls complete project information including timeline, materials, crew assignments, and customer preferences. Gathers data needed for personalized communication.

  3. 3
    Decision

    Determine Communication Type

    Evaluates project status to select appropriate communication template and delivery method. Routes to material delivery updates, progress photos, or completion notifications.

  4. 4
    Action

    Capture Progress Documentation

    Automatically retrieves latest project photos from field crews and generates before/after comparisons. Creates visual proof of work completion for customer review.

  5. 5
    Action

    Generate Personalized Update

    Creates customized message with project photos, timeline updates, and next steps. Includes weather delays, material arrivals, or quality inspections as relevant.

  6. 6
    Action

    Send Multi-Channel Communication

    Delivers update via customer's preferred method including SMS, email, or in-app notifications. Includes photo galleries and project timeline visualization.

  7. 7
    Output

    Log Communication History

    Records all sent communications in customer file with delivery confirmations and engagement metrics. Updates customer satisfaction tracking and project documentation.

Outputs

  • Automated project status notifications
  • Photo-documented progress updates
  • Complete communication audit trail

Key Metrics

  • Customer response time to updates
  • Communication delivery success rate
  • Project milestone completion accuracy
OA

Want to build this workflow yourself?

Operator Academy teaches you how to implement AI automation workflows like this one step-by-step — no coding required.

Start Learning at Operator Academy

Ready to transform your Roofing operations?

Get a personalized AI implementation roadmap tailored to your business goals, current tech stack, and team readiness.

Book a Strategy CallFree 30-minute AI OS assessment